Anne Barge has been a top name in bridal for nearly 20 years. Her eponymous Atlanta-based company, now with Shawne Jacobs at the helm, just opened an appointment-only atelier. Known for her feminine, classic style, Barge reveals this season’s most in-demand bridal trends:

Bows
“Think Dior bows,” Barge says. “Very couture, sophisticated, and strategically placed. There’s nothing ‘little girl’ about them.”

Overskirts
“Overskirts have always been a glamorous accessory, but they are definitely on-trend now­—especially when they’re removable, so they provide an easy 2-in-1 to go from the ceremony to dancing at the reception,” Barge says.

Long sleeves
“The red carpet influences bridal so directly, and we’re seeing that in a very sophisticated and confident way with longer sleeves. We call it ‘modern modesty,’” Barge says. 120 Interstate N. Parkway, Suite 404, 404-873-8070, annebarge.com
